Administrative / biographical background: |
The Axholme Joint Railway was promoted jointly by the North Eastern Railway and the Lancashire and Yorkshire Railway. The mainline of the railway ran from the North Eastern Railway at Marshland Junction, south of Goole, to the Great Northern and Great Eastern Joint Railway south of Haxey. There were branches from Reedness Junction to Fockerby and from Epworth to Hatfield Moors Depot (see below) |
